Meaning

The Handheld Devices Battery Market encompasses the production, distribution, and utilization of batteries specifically designed for powering handheld electronic devices. These batteries come in various forms, including lithium-ion (Li-ion), lithium-polymer (LiPo), nickel-cadmium (NiCd), and nickel-metal hydride (NiMH), each offering different characteristics in terms of energy density, size, weight, and rechargeability. As handheld devices become indispensable tools in daily life and work, the demand for efficient, reliable, and long-lasting batteries continues to grow.

Market Key Trends

  1. Advancements in Battery Chemistry: Continued research and development efforts focus on improving battery energy density, cycle life, safety, and environmental sustainability through innovations in electrode materials, electrolytes, and cell designs.
  2. Fast-Charging Solutions: Fast-charging technologies, including gallium nitride (GaN) chargers, USB Power Delivery (USB PD), and Qualcomm Quick Charge, enable rapid charging of handheld devices, reducing downtime and enhancing user convenience.
  3. Wireless Charging Integration: The integration of wireless charging capabilities into handheld devices and accessories, along with the proliferation of Qi-standard wireless charging pads and furniture, promotes cord-free convenience and charging versatility.
  4. Battery Management Systems (BMS): Advanced battery management systems incorporating artificial intelligence (AI), machine learning, and predictive analytics optimize battery performance, prolong lifespan, and enhance safety by monitoring and regulating charging and discharging processes.
